Islamic Traditions [IO Islamic 2234] کتاب بهجة المحافل

Abstract

Tradition. This manuscript is now IO Islamic 2234 in the India Office collections. [metadata: Otto Loth, A Catalogue of the Arabic Manuscripts in the Library of the India Office, (volume 1), no. 173 here with further notations and hyperlinks]. 173. 2234. Size 121/4 in. by 81/2 in.; foll. 138. About thirty-two lines in a page. کتاب بهجة المحافل، و بغیة الاماثل، فی السیر و الاخلاق و الشمائل، فی سیرة سید الاواخر و الاوائل A compendious work on the life, person, and character of Muḥammad, by ABU ZAKARÎYÂ ‘IMÂD AL-DÎN YAḤYA B. ABU BAKR ‘ÂMIRÎ (d. A. H. 893), who completed it, according to the epilogue, in Ramaḍan, 855 [=1451 CE].1 Cf. Ḥ. Kh. ii. 74, and Stewart’s Catal. 33. This work is divided into three parts (قسم), a survey of which is given at the beginning. Part I. فی تلخیص سیرته صلعم من مولده الی وفاته و ما یتعلق بذلک, in six chapters. II. القسم الثانی فی اسمائه الکریمة و خلقته الوسیمة و خصائصه و معجزاته و باهر آیاته , in four chapters. III. القسم الثالث فی شمائله و فضائله و اقواله و افعاله فی جمیع احواله, in three chapters. The author used the works of various predecessors, among whom he points out Ibn Isḥâḳ and Ṭabarî, Tirmidhî and Ibn Ḥibbân, and ‘Iyâḍ. Plainly written, by Sa’îd b. Ṣalâḥ الفقیلی (?), apparently in Southern Arabia. Headings in large characters. Coloured lines round the pages of the first portion. Notes. Foll. 106 and 116 have been misplaced; they should stand together between foll. 60 and 61. Signatures of various owners: first a prince named احمد بن حسن بن اسحق بن امیر المومنین المهدی لدین الله احمد بن حسن, Ramaḍan, 1158 [=1745 CE]; then ‘Abd al-rabb, of Kaukabân (ed. note: in Yemen: كوكبان), A.H. 1159 [=1746 CE]; after him his daughter Fâṭimah, A. H. 1177 [=1763-64 CE], etc. [Coll. Fort William, 1825.] 1The present MS. has the date, Friday, 10 Ramaḍan which is not correct.
